Everything you need to know about Buffering in IPTV
Buffering is a generic term. It is associated with different technologies and it gives out different meanings. In this article, the main objective of us is to deep dive and learn more about Buffering in IPTV.
When you are watching IPTV content, you must have come across buffering. In here, the live stream would pause for a moment. It will resume after a short time period. You will not have to do anything and it would automatically resume. This scenario is called as buffering. Depending on the player that you use to enjoy IPTV content, you will be able to notice buffering, loading or something related to this displayed on the screen. The process of buffering has the ability to speed up the different tasks that you are running on the computer.
What is buffering?
One of the main objectives of buffering is to prevent lag, which you can experience e while you are streaming a video over the internet. Or else, it can provide you with support and assistance that is needed to overcome slow performance in enjoying a video. At the time of playing a video game, where there are rich graphics, you will come across buffering as well.
During the buffering process, the application you use will pre-load data into a specific area in memory. This area in memory is called as buffer. Along with that, you will be provided with the opportunity to get the CPU and GPU to access data quickly.
This is the simplest definition that we can give to buffering. Under this simple definition, there are numerous technical definitions and it is quite difficult for us to get to know about all of them. Hence, we encourage you to keep the basic definition in your mind for the moment and proceed.
What factors would lead you towards buffering?
There are numerous factors, which can lead you to buffering. Here are some of the most prominent factors out of them. If you want to overcome buffering, you will have to provide solutions to these causes.
Internet speed can be considered as the main reason behind buffering. If you have a slow internet speed, you will more often have to experience buffering. But if your internet speed is fast, you will not have to experience any buffering at all. This is because the internet speed is not enough to deliver the data that is needed by the video player to play. Hence, the video player gets into the buffering stage and waits until it collects some data. When sufficient amount of data is collected within the buffer, it would come out from the buffering mode and provide you with the chance to enjoy content again.
Number of devices connected to the home network
Home networks are usually equipped with numerous devices. All these devices can share the resources. Hence, you will run into buffering. For example, if another person who is connected to the home network is streaming, the bandwidth will be shared. In such a situation, your bandwidth would not be enough to provide you with data content at a steady pace. Hence, you will run into the buffering stage.
There is a direct relationship in between CPU usage and buffering as well. If your CPU usage is high, there is a possibility for you to experience buffering most of the time. That’s because the CPU would be utilized among different applications. All the applications that are running on the background would use the available resources in CPU and RAM. Hence, the application that plays your streaming media content will not be allocated with enough resources to offer the functionality. This is another instance where you will have to experience buffering.
Overloading by the stream provider
In some of the instances, you media streaming provider can also act as the contributor for buffering. In here, the server of your media content provider will get too many requests. The server will not be able to accommodate that many requests. Hence, you will have to experience buffering. During such a situation, nobody connected to the server will be able to get a buffering free experience. The number of users should go down in order to provide assistance to you with enabling buffering.
How to prevent buffering?
There are three main factors, which can contribute towards buffering. They include internet speed, hardware capabilities and the IPTV server. If there are changes to the internet speed, you will have to experience buffering as well. That’s because the player that you use will not be able to keep up pace with the buffering. It will be subjected to numerous changes along with time and it would eventually run into buffering mode.
Some of the older media devices are not in a position to accept and handle high quality videos. If you are using such a media box or a television, you will have to experience buffering as well. That’s because it is not technically designed in order to handle the high quality input requests. Due to the same reason, you will run into buffering.
If you want to minimize buffering that you experience when watching IPTV content, you should invest your money on an appropriate device with hardware specifications. Then you should think about investing separately to get a high speed internet connection as well. There are some apps, which are specifically designed to deliver assistance with IPTV content streaming. If you can stick to such an app, you can reduce buffering up to a great extent as well. Smart TV app, Kodi Media Player and VLC Media Player are perfect examples for such apps that are available for you to consider.
Along with making these changes on your end, you must ensure that you are seeking the assistance of an expert IPTV service provider, who can provide high speed content without any buffering.